BlackRock-Backed Securitize To Raise $400M Nears Public Debut; CEPT jumps 8%

Securitize, one of the largest providers of tokenization infrastructure to Wall Street, expects to raise about $400 million as it prepares to go public through a merger with a Cantor Fitzgerald-backed special-purpose buyout firm. Ethereum tax company Sharplink takes in ether for the first time in eight months

Sharplink (SBET) apparently bought 5,000 ether (ETH) worth about $7.85 million on Thursday, its first ether influx in eight months, according to Arkham data showing the coins arriving from crypto brokerage FalconX.
